Momentum in Spain: Interblock boosts operations with key licenses and service center commitment
2 minutos de lectura
(Spain).- In a pivotal stride forward, Interblock Spain proudly announces the acquisition of manufacturers' licenses in six jurisdictions in Spain: Andalucía, Canarias, Pais Vasco, La Rioja, Castilla la Mancha and Navara. This latest development solidifies Interblock’s position in the Spanish market and underscores the Company’s unyielding dedication to delivering top-tier services in the region.

Interblock, the world's leading developer and supplier of luxury electronic table gaming products announces the new acquisition of Spanish licenses.
John Connelly, Global CEO of Interblock, commented on the matter, "Our commitment to Spain is steadfast and ever-growing".
"With more than 10,000 seats in operation across the country, these new licenses don't just expand our reach—they emphasize our relentless pursuit of providing unparalleled service to our esteemed clientele.”
The newly acquired licenses allow Interblock Spain to sell its esteemed products directly, providing clients seamless access to the industry's best. Moreover, existing Interblock product owners in Spain can expect enhanced support, heralding a renewed focus on customer dedication.
This milestone, while significant, is just one step in a broader vision. Plans are in motion for Interblock Spain to launch a state-of-the-art service center and warehouse in the upcoming months. Designed specifically for Spanish customers, the 24/7 service center enhances the company's support capabilities, ensuring clients get prompt and efficient assistance whenever needed.
Interblock Spain is actively pursuing manufacturers' licenses in the remaining Spanish jurisdictions. The Company's forward-looking enthusiasm resonates with a clear ambition: to continually amplify the delivery of first-rate services and products.
